John Cornyn

U.S. senator · since 2002
John Cornyn III is an American politician and former judge who is the senior United States senator from Texas , a seat he has held since 2002. He is a member of the Republican Party .
Born 1952 · Houston , Texas, U.S.

Where Cornyn stands
AI · from the record
National defense
Record includes the National Defense Authorization Act for Fiscal Year 2026, which became law in 2025 (Public Law No. 119-60).
Border security & trade
Record includes the CTPAT Pilot Program Act of 2023 and the Starr–Camargo Bridge Expansion Act, both of which became law in 2023 (Public Law Nos. 118-98 and 118-80).
Commemorative legislation
Record includes the Dustoff Crews of the Vietnam War Congressional Gold Medal Act (2023), the Jocelyn Nungaray National Wildlife Refuge Act (2025), and the Holocaust Expropriated Art Recovery Act of 2025, all of which became law (Public Law Nos. 118-87, 119-30, and 119-82).
Party independence
Votes with the Republican party 100% of the time across 841 roll-call votes in the 119th Congress (Senate), with zero recorded breaks.
